Transitioning From Casual to Corporate: Building a Business-Ready Wardrobe
Navigating your transition from casual attire to corporate dress can feel like a daunting task. It's essential to curate an wardrobe that projects poise while adhering to office expectations. Begin by acquiring foundational pieces like tailored blazers, crisp tops, and well-fitting trousers. Choose classic colors such as black, navy, gray, and white with a base, then add pops of color with accessories or statement items. Remember, it's about striking the balance between style and suitability.
- Consider your workplace environment to determine the appropriate level of formality.
- Prioritize quality over amount. Well-made garments will last longer and look more sophisticated.
- Complement your outfits with appropriate jewelry, a watch, or a scarf to add a personal touch.
By following these tips, you can develop a business-ready wardrobe that makes yourself feel confident and equipped to succeed in the corporate world.
